Revenue Science, Inc. has released a study conducted by JupiterResearch that found online users are consistently more receptive to behaviorally targeted advertisements than contextual advertising. Results showed that targeted behavioral ads outperformed contextual ads up to 22%. Also found was that the audience interested in behavioral ads is considered of higher value because they, on average have a higher income, spend more money online and shop more often online. However, behaviorally targeted ads performed better with both higher and lower spectrum spenders.
